Residents of Petersburg, Virginia who struggle to access healthcare now have an easy and flexible option available to them every week. Sentara, a nonprofit healthcare organization, recently launched Sentara Mobile Care in Petersburg as part of its Sentara Community Care program. This program provides primary care, behavioral health, and social support services to people who cannot access traditional healthcare due to lack of transportation or time constraints.

The official launch of Sentara Mobile Care in Petersburg was celebrated with a ribbon-cutting ceremony on May 25 at the Petersburg Public Library. After the ceremony, the mobile care unit will be available to Petersburg residents every Thursday between 10 a.m. and 1 p.m. at The Hope Center located at 827 Commerce Street, and every Thursday from 2 p.m. to 5 p.m. at the Petersburg Public Library.

- Advertisement -

“We have been involved in and committed to improving the health of the Petersburg community for over 25 years,” said Linda Hines, Medicaid Plan President of Sentara Health Plans. “Our Sentara Mobile Care vehicle in Petersburg is another step in our ongoing journey to create greater health equity and access to care in the communities we serve.”

Sentara plans to expand their services in the future, including further behavioral health services supported by a new $2 million fund and introducing women’s health services to their offerings. Sentara Mobile Care vehicles and Community Care Centers are already serving communities in Hampton Roads and Northern Virginia.
